嵌入式系统原理及应用开发技术复习资料 一、填空题 1. 嵌入式系统的主要特征有:技术密集、专用紧凑、安全可靠、多种多样、及时响应、成本敏感、开发困难、不可垄断等。 2. AMBA 总线结构包括ASB、 AHB 和 APB 总线。ASB/AHB 用于CPU与存储器、DMA 控制器、总线仲裁控制器等片上系统中芯片的连接,APB 用于连接低速的外围设备。 3. 嵌入式系统是以应用为中心,以计算机技术为基础,软硬件可配置,对功能、可靠性、成本、体积功耗有严格约束的专用系统,所用的计算机称为嵌入式计算机。 4.衡量系统的实时性用响应时间、吞吐量、生存时间三个指标 5.实时系统分实时控制系统和实时信息处理系统。 6.能够在限定的响应时间内提供所需水平服务的计算机系统称实时系统。没有时间约束的快速系统是非实时系统。 7. ARM9TDMI 采用5 级流水线:取指、译码、执行、访存和写回。 8. 嵌入式系统由硬件和软件两大部分组成。 9. 嵌入式微处理器有嵌入式微处理器、嵌入式微控制器、曲入式 DSP 处理器和嵌入式片上系统四种类型。 10. ARM 微处理器共有37 个 32 位寄存器。其中31 个通用寄存器(包括程序计数器PC), 6 个状态寄存器。 11. ARM 微处理器是典型的RISC 微处理器,只有Load/Store 指令可以访问存储器,数据处理指令只对寄存器的内容进行操作。 12. ARM 微处理器有ARM 和Thumb 两种工作状态。ARM 状态是32位,执行字对准的ARM 指令。Thumb 状态是16 位,执行半字对准的 Thumb 指令。 13.不同的中断处理不同的处理模式,具有不同的优先级,而且每个中断都有固定的中断入口地址。当一个中断发生时,相应的R14存储中断返回地址,SPSR 存储状态寄存器CPSR 的值。 二、选择填空 1.当一个中断发生时,相应的(A)存储中断返回地址。 A. R14 B.R1 C.R2 D.R15 2. ARM 内核支持(A)种中断和异常。 A. 7 B.2 C.5 D.1 3.不同的中断处理不同的处理模式,具有不同的优先级,而且每个中断都有(A)的中断入口地址。当一个中断发生时,相应的R14存储中断返回地址,SPSR 存储状态寄存器CPSR 的值。 A.固定 B.动态 C.不确定 D.随机 4.在指令系统的各种寻址方式中,若操作数的地址包含在指令中,则属于( A )直接寻址。 A. 直接寻址 B. 立即寻址 C. 寄存器寻址 D. 间接寻址 5. ARM9TDMI 采用(C)级流水线。 A. 1 B.2 C.5 D.10 6. 嵌入式GUI 设...